What Lies in the Multiverse
|
|
03/03/2022 |

|
75 |
|
What Lies In The Multiverse is a 2D platformer about a Kid accompanying an interdimensional traveler across universes as they seek to stop things from falling apart. It has wonderful aesthetics, an entertaining sincere narrative, and a fun universe-switching mechanic. Sadly, it lacks difficulty while restraining universes you can access throughout the game. Despite that, the reality is that this game will take you on an enjoyable and meaningful romp across realities.

Per Aspera
|
|
03/12/2020 |

|
80 |
|
Per Aspera is a stunningly realistic "planet builder" in which you play as an AI tasked with terraforming Mars. Although its pace is sometimes slow, it is an extremely educational game with a surprisingly deep and touching story.
